Gong helps people and companies reach their potential. The Gong Revenue Intelligence Platform™ enables customer-facing teams to take advantage of their most valuable assets – customer interactions, which the Gong platform automatically captures and analyzes. Gong then delivers insights at scale, to empower revenue and go-to-market teams to determine the best actions for winning outcomes. Provides executive summaries for meeting notes and email follow ups.
AI Briefs allow anyone to seek information on a particular customer in a matter of seconds.
Scores calls such as EBRs or new business sales calls that can be used by management for coaching.
Provides accurate forecasting and visibility to sales leaders.
Theme spotter can be used to gather feedback and provide data to management for opportunities we continuously here from our clients.
Accurately depict key points from conversations and allows for different brief themes to quickly get the information needed for teammates throughout the organization.
Sometimes Gong doesn't understand the context of the sentence and mistranslates the transcripts, leading to confusion and requiring manual review.
The generated reports aren't as detailed, especially the Gong Engage reports. Extra steps are required to search for useful information, which is only available in the CSV files, which contain the complete information needed for proper analysis.
I would like a feature where I can automatically tag groups of calls, making it easier to search for information in transcripts without having to go call by call or do that work myself.
